Description
The first comprehensive exploration of disability and citizenship in Chinese society and culture from 1949 to the present day.
About the Author
Sarah Dauncey is Associate Professor at the University of Nottingham. She has published extensively on identity, disability, gender and culture from late imperial times to the present. She is co-editor of Writing Lives in China, 1600-2010: Histories of the Elusive Self (2013).
